自动化建表工具:快速生成Excel数据表语句
需积分: 5 118 浏览量
更新于2024-10-14
收藏 14.38MB RAR 举报
资源摘要信息:"datatools.rar"
根据文件描述,datatools.rar是一个压缩文件包,它包含用于自动生成数据库建表语句的工具,旨在帮助解决处理数据字段较多的建表场景。这种工具通常对数据库管理员、数据工程师以及需要频繁进行数据处理的专业人士非常有帮助。以下是相关的知识点:
1. 数据库建表语句:在数据库管理系统中,建表语句(如SQL中的CREATE TABLE语句)用于创建新的数据库表。每个表都是由多个字段组成,字段类型、长度、是否允许为空等属性都需要在建表时定义。当处理具有大量字段的表格时,手动编写建表语句不仅耗时而且容易出错。
2. 自动化工具:自动化工具可以解析Excel文件中的内容,并据此生成相应的建表语句。这样的工具通常会包含以下功能:
- 读取Excel文件:从Excel中提取必要的信息,如表名、字段名、字段类型等。
- 格式转换:将Excel格式的数据转换为可识别的建表语句结构。
- 语句生成:基于读取和转换后的数据,生成适用于目标数据库管理系统的建表语句。
- 错误检测:在生成过程中检测数据格式的错误并给出提示,提高语句的准确性。
3. Excel文件内容:Excel是微软开发的一种表格处理软件,广泛用于数据存储、分析和展示。它允许用户组织和格式化数据,也可以通过其数据导出功能来准备用于建表的数据。
4. 数据库管理系统:建表语句生成工具通常是针对特定的数据库管理系统设计的,如MySQL、Oracle、SQL Server等。不同的数据库系统使用略有不同的建表语句语法,因此工具需要能够识别并适应目标系统的要求。
5. 压缩包内容:提到的压缩包"datatools.rar"中包含了两个文件:word.data和data2.exe。word.data可能是一个示例或模板文件,用于展示或测试工具功能;data2.exe可能是一个执行程序,通过运行这个程序来执行自动化建表任务。
6. 运维工具:在IT行业,运维工具指的是用于支持日常运维任务的各种软件,其中可能包括数据库管理、服务器监控、自动化脚本等。本例中的自动化建表工具即属于数据库管理类的运维工具。
7. 关键技术点:
- 数据解析技术:解析Excel文件数据,提取关键建表信息。
- 数据库语法适应技术:根据不同数据库系统的语法规则生成正确的建表语句。
- 用户交互界面:提供直观的用户交互方式,以便用户能够上传Excel文件、设定参数以及获取生成的建表语句。
8. 使用场景:在数据迁移、批量数据处理、数据仓库建设等场景下,该工具能够大幅提升工作效率,减少人工错误,加速项目实施周期。
综合以上知识点,我们可以看出datatools.rar文件是一个针对数据库建表工作提供的自动化解决方案,通过处理Excel文件内容,帮助用户快速生成适用于多种数据库管理系统的建表语句。该工具非常适合需要高效处理复杂数据建表任务的IT专业人员使用。
2019-10-24 上传
2017-03-30 上传
2010-12-01 上传
2019-07-12 上传
2012-10-26 上传
2022-09-24 上传
2020-08-12 上传
2020-04-10 上传
flyingant9
- 粉丝: 10
- 资源: 2
最新资源
- 火炬连体网络在MNIST的2D嵌入实现示例
- Angular插件增强Application Insights JavaScript SDK功能
- 实时三维重建:InfiniTAM的ros驱动应用
- Spring与Mybatis整合的配置与实践
- Vozy前端技术测试深入体验与模板参考
- React应用实现语音转文字功能介绍
- PHPMailer-6.6.4: PHP邮件收发类库的详细介绍
- Felineboard:为猫主人设计的交互式仪表板
- PGRFileManager:功能强大的开源Ajax文件管理器
- Pytest-Html定制测试报告与源代码封装教程
- Angular开发与部署指南:从创建到测试
- BASIC-BINARY-IPC系统:进程间通信的非阻塞接口
- LTK3D: Common Lisp中的基础3D图形实现
- Timer-Counter-Lister:官方源代码及更新发布
- Galaxia REST API:面向地球问题的解决方案
- Node.js模块:随机动物实例教程与源码解析